UpdateQuoteInput
Provides the fields and values to use when updating a quote.
input UpdateQuoteInput {
id: ID!
status: ID
clientId: ID
personId: ID
issuerId: ID
priceListId: ID
effectiveAt: Date
dueAt: Date
currency: CurrencyCode
discount: Decimal
notes: String
lines: UpdateQuoteLinesInput
properties: RelatedPropertiesInput
tasks: RelatedTasksInput
letters: RelatedLettersInput
contracts: RelatedContractsInput
projects: RelatedProjectsInput
}
Fields
UpdateQuoteInput.id
● ID!
non-null scalar
Specifies the quote to update.
UpdateQuoteInput.status
● ID
scalar
The quote's status.
UpdateQuoteInput.clientId
● ID
scalar
The quote's client.
UpdateQuoteInput.personId
● ID
scalar
The quote's client related person.
UpdateQuoteInput.issuerId
● ID
scalar
The quote's issuer.
UpdateQuoteInput.priceListId
● ID
scalar
The quote's price list.
UpdateQuoteInput.effectiveAt
● Date
scalar
Effective date of the quote.
UpdateQuoteInput.dueAt
● Date
scalar
Due date of the quote.
UpdateQuoteInput.currency
● CurrencyCode
enum
The quote's currency.
UpdateQuoteInput.discount
● Decimal
scalar
The quote's discount percentage.
UpdateQuoteInput.notes
● String
scalar
The quote's notes.
UpdateQuoteInput.lines
● UpdateQuoteLinesInput
input
The quote's lines.
UpdateQuoteInput.properties
● RelatedPropertiesInput
input
The quote's properties relation.
UpdateQuoteInput.tasks
● RelatedTasksInput
input
The quote's tasks relation.
UpdateQuoteInput.letters
● RelatedLettersInput
input
The quote's letters relation.
UpdateQuoteInput.contracts
● RelatedContractsInput
input
The quote's contracts relation.
UpdateQuoteInput.projects
● RelatedProjectsInput
input
The quote's projects relation.
Member Of
updateQuote
mutation